Cryo-EM structures of lipopolysaccharide transporter LptB2FGC in lipopolysaccharide or AMP-PNP-bound states reveal its transport mechanism

Seven lipopolysaccharide (LPS) transport proteins (LptBFGCADE) mediate the transport of LPS from the inner to the outer membrane of Gram-negative bacteria. Here the authors provide mechanistic insights into LPS recognition and transportation by determining the cryo-EM structures of the inner membrane complex LptB2FGC bound to either LPS or AMP-PNP.
